Lt. Gov. Rodgers announces reelection bid

MONTPELIER, Vt. (WCAX) – Republican Lieutenant Governor John Rodgers announced Tuesday he is running for a second term, saying he wants to continue working to build Vermont’s workforce, make the state more affordable, and help the next generation of Vermonters stay in the state.

Rodgers said he wants to elevate Vermonters’ voices at the state level and give a platform to those who are underrepresented in government.

“I will keep working with the governor’s office and legislators every day, building bridges necessary to defeat the affordability crisis taxing us and holding us back,” Rodgers said.

The former Democrat was elected two years ago when the GOP made historic gains at the Statehouse. He’s the only Republican to announce so far.

Three Democrats are vying for their party’s nomination: Molly Gray, Ryan McLaren, and Esther Charlestin.
